My 13 year old side by side quit cooling. I replaced the overload and relay on the compressor and it started cooling for about a day and then quit again. I checked the evaporator coils in the freezer side and they look fine. The lights come on in both sides but nothing else is running (fans, compressor, etc.). Any ideas or suggestions?

Since the compressor and fans are not on it is probably a main thermostat or a defrost timer problem.

Try turning the main thermostat to off and then back on. if the unit fires up replace the thermostat.

If the above does nothing, leave the thermostat on and turn the defrost timer (item 6 in section 11) cam. There is usually a hole in the cover so that you can do this with a screwdriver without any dis-assembly. It only turns in one direction. If the unit fires up replace the timer re: you were stuck in a defrost cycle.

If neither of the above does anything.
Unplug the unit and measure across the main thermostat contacts, should be 0 ohms (closed) if not replace the thermostat.
If you do not have a meter you could short the two thermostat wires together and then plug it in to see if it works. Just be careful that nothing can short to anything else.

I took your advice and determined that the main thermostat needed to be replaced. I replaced it yesterday, it took about 15 minutes, and my refrigerator is working like a champ. Plus I scored bonus points with the wife. haha Thanks again!!
